The Ethical Considerations and Future Trajectory in the US Context

\n

As AI tools become more sophisticated, the ethical implications for academic integrity in the United States are paramount. Both 99Papers and PaperCoach, like other services in this space, must navigate the fine line between providing legitimate academic assistance and facilitating plagiarism or academic dishonesty. Universities across the US are increasingly implementing AI detection software, making it crucial for students to use these tools responsibly. The key lies in understanding that AI-assisted services should be viewed as tools for learning and improvement, not as shortcuts to completing assignments. For example, a student using an AI tool to brainstorm ideas or refine sentence structure is engaging in a different practice than one who submits AI-generated content as their own. The future trajectory of these services will likely involve greater transparency about their AI usage and stronger partnerships with educational institutions to promote ethical academic practices. As AI capabilities expand, the focus will shift towards services that empower students to become better writers and critical thinkers, rather than simply providing finished products. This evolving dynamic requires students to be informed consumers, understanding the capabilities and limitations of AI in their academic pursuits.
